def test_single_story(self): fetch_stories() self.assertEqual( redis.hgetall('story:52'), dict( current_state='unscheduled', ) )
def test_stories_unscheduled(self): self.assertEqual(redis.scard('stories:unscheduled'), 0) fetch_stories() self.assertEqual(redis.scard('stories:unscheduled'), 1)
def test_stories(self): self.assertEqual(redis.scard('stories'), 0) fetch_stories() self.assertEqual(redis.scard('stories'), 1)
def fetch_stories(): from wafwfy.tasks import fetch_stories fetch_stories(refresh_clients=True)